General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1910.147(c)(1): Energy control program. The employer shall establish a program consisting of energy control procedures, employee training and periodic inspections to ensure that before any employee performs any servicing or maintenance on a machine or equipment where the unexpected energizing, startup or release of stored energy could occur and cause injury, the machine or equipment shall be isolated from the energy source and rendered inoperative. a) Production area: On or about January 16, 2020, and at times prior, the employer exposed employees to caught-in hazards in that they are required to change blade assemblies periodically on the TTARP carpet cutter (Model P3228M13BR Serial Number 131210) without following specific lock-out procedures. The employer has not established a program consisting of energy control procedures, employee training and periodic inspections.

General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1910.147(c)(7)(i)(C): All other employees whose work operations are or may be in an area where energy control procedures may be utilized, shall be instructed about the procedure, and about the prohibition relating to attempts to restart or re-energize machines or equipment which are locked out or tagged out. a) Production area: On or about January 16, 2020, and at times prior, the employer exposed Packer employees to struck-by and caught-in hazards, in that the employees were not instructed on lock-out/tag-out procedures and the prohibition to restarting or re-energize equipment, such as but not limited to the TTARP carpet cutter (Model P3228M13BR Serial Number 131210).

General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1910.147(d)(1): Preparation for shutdown. Before an authorized or affected employee turns off a machine or equipment, the authorized employee shall have knowledge of the type and magnitude of the energy, the hazards of the energy to be controlled, and the method or means to control the energy. a) Production area: On or about January 16, 2020, and times prior, the employer exposed employees to caught-in hazards, in that the employee did not have knowledge of the type and magnitude of the energy, the hazards of the energy to be controlled, and the method or means to control the energy before the authorized or affected employee turned off the TTARP carpet cutter (Model P3228M13BR Serial Number 131210).
